According to Lincoln County Utilities, the property has access to Lincoln County water but not sewer. The Deed Book 3447 Pages 942-944 acreage is 7.09 acres and runs to the center of Hwy 73. The Lincoln County calculated acreage is 6.44 acres and doesn't include the acreage in the right of way. The last survey was surveyed and platted by Hoke S. Heavner, County Surveyor, July 31, 1965.
